What would be the next step
 
Hey guys. I have a Miss Vegas that has reached consistent 60mph runs with a best of 60.8. I run a NEU 1521 1.5d motor, Two 4900 mah 11.1 batterys, and a Octura m545 modded. The hull has been modded ,bottom has been cut and is flat. Prop is extended 2.5 inches back. It has a very short rudder to reduce drag and short turn fin. I have tried 9 different props and this prop has pruven to be the best. Run time is great and for just messing around i will run two 7.4 volts with even better run time. My goal has always been 65 mph but no matter what i do she will not pass the 60 mark.I know this hull was not ment for this but its cheap, especially when it crashes,losses radio contact wich is always a good time LOL and hit a few things so finding them on ebay is easy and cheap. What do you think my next move should be. Mabe a custom prop? 50volt esc and more voltage batterys? Thanks for your time

RE: What would be the next step
 
Honestly, get a bettter hull. A hull designed around a 4s2p rigger could easily accomodate your current 6s 1521 power system. You will be able to exceed 65mph and should be over 70mph. There comes a time when you will want that extra 5mph, why not start now before dumping more money. Build a hull toss some hardware on it and re-use your current power sytem.
